Complete the Reply to Offer of Admission Form and submit a deposit of $300 to confirm your child's place in the Class of 2028 or the spring 2024 transfer class.

You can do this in one of the following ways:

  • Online with payment by credit card. Your child will need to log in to their myJCU Gateway portal to electronically accept their offer of admission. Then, you will be able to pay the $300 deposit online.
  • By mail with payment by check. Download a pdf of the Reply to Offer of Admission Form. Deposits sent by mail must be postmarked on or before May 1, 2024, for first-year students and on or before January 6, 2024 for transfer students.*

The enrollment deposit is $300* for all incoming students. For on-campus residents, $100 of this deposit serves as an advance payment on the first semester bill. The other $200 will be placed as a housing security deposit. For commuter students, the entire $300 deposit serves as an advance payment on your first semester bill.

*An enrollment deposit represents your child's intent to enroll at John Carroll for the fall semester. We expect that a student who has a deposit on account at John Carroll will attend. When students cancel their deposits, this may prevent other eligible students from choosing JCU and will impact our planning for the new semester courses and housing. As a result, the $300 deposit is not refundable after May 1 for first-year students. No exceptions are made to this rule. Although we are not able to grant extensions to these deadlines, we will accept enrollment deposits from admitted students after these dates on a space available basis.

The following represents a timeline of some important dates and steps to take in the enrollment process:

2023

  • December 2023 – File the FAFSA
    • Apply for financial aid, free of charge, at www.fafsa.gov. This year, the U.S. Department of Education is making changes to the FAFSA filing process. For more information about how to prepare to file the FAFSA in December, please click here

2024

  • February 1 – Mission-Based Programs application due by 11:59 p.m. Eastern for first-year students. Programs: Arrupe Scholars, Leadership Scholars, Honors Program, and Social Innovation Fellows. The application will be available in your child's myJCU Gateway. 
  • Mid-February – Financial aid award notification begins
  • March 1 – The housing application opens, and the Student Health Form application opens
  • March 1 – Orientation registration opens
  • March 23 – Admitted Student Celebration - an event celebrating your student's acceptance to JCU.
  • May 1 – Reply to Offer of Admission Forms due (postmarked)
  • Summer 2024 – Attend a New Student Orientation or Transfer Registration Day
  • August 19  – Fall classes begin
